Investigate the Effect of Permeability on the Selection of Diverter in Limestone Matrix Acidizing

This paper will aim at investigating effect of permeability on selecting best diverter in carbonate matrix acidizing. Two types of diverters were used, 15% HCl Gelled Acid and Slickwater+15% HCl. Permeability varied from 50md, 100 and 300md. Results showed that 15% HCl Gelled Acid gave better results than VDA where it had lower skin value and better invasion depth.
